Can an order be changed before production starts?
I ordered mine a few weeks ago and it hasn't moved past the "order processed" stage. I got the SAP and DHP as well as alot of other stuff. If I wanted to change to Msport can it be done? So in other words, can I just substitute Msport for SAP but keep the DHP? It looks to be about a $1200 difference (MSRP). And what does Sport Suspension Delete mean under the Msport pricing?Thanks. If it can't be done I'm ok with the original order too.

As above you can amend your order under it goes in to build status at which point you cannot change it. Each change to an order has the potential to shift the build date forward or backward depending on the availability of parts as they all come together (in theory) at build time as part of the stock management process.. all very slick.
I went for the M model and also picked the delete option. This gives you the option to select the suspension you want via the sport/sport plus settings. I've never driven purely M sport without this, and most of the reviews i've read since suggest that driving in sports model with the suspension enabled is similar or the same as having M sport suspension. For UK roads, I like to be able to have additional comfort and think I would have missed selection the option to disable it as sometimes its a little too hard. |

It's actually "locked" for changes about a week before production begins. I made quite a few additions and changes to my options (including one about two weeks before production started) and only the last change was refused because it was too late. That one was about 3 days before the start of production and I was told I couldn't make changes as the order had been accepted at the plant but wasn't yet "physical"
